基于Semantic-UI Grid的页面布局:无法移除排水沟

use*_*647 10 html css semantic-ui

我正在创建一个Web应用程序semantic-ui.我正在尝试创建一个具有侧边栏和主要内容区域的布局.起初,我认为使用网格是可行的方法,除了它们会导致一些问题:

  1. 列和行之间将有额外的间距/排水沟
  2. "移除"排水沟的唯一方法是使用类似的方式设置列颜色<div class="four wide black column">,但这会导致列与其他内容重叠

如此看来,电网不创建页面布局的最佳工具,虽然他们提供的功能,这使得他们对页面布局有用(如定义截面尺寸; four wide column,ten wide column等)

使用Semantic-UI布局Web应用程序的推荐方法是什么,例如简单的侧边栏和主要内容列?

San*_*ath 1

为什么不像这样覆盖应用于“网格”和“列”的默认边距和填充,

.your-custom-class.grid {
    margin: 0;
}
.your-custom-class.grid .column {
    padding: 0;
}
Run Code Online (Sandbox Code Playgroud)

因此,您将得到一个列之间没有空间的网格。